Trump Admin Sues Los Angeles Over Sanctuary City Policies
Immigration,Trump Administration,Los Angeles,California,Sanctuary Cities,Immigration Reform,Lawsuit
The Trump administration is challenging Los Angeles’ sanctuary city policies in court, the latest major city to be targeted for laws that restrict cooperation between federal immigration authorities and local law enforcement.
The Department of Justice (DOJ) filed a lawsuit Monday against the City of Los Angeles, according to court documents obtained by the Daily Caller News Foundation. In its lawsuit, federal prosecutors claim LA’s sanctuary laws not only obstruct Immigration and Customs Enforcement’s (ICE) mission, but also violate the Supremacy Clause of the U.S. Constitution...
